Abstract

Trivalent dysprosium ions co-doped NaYF4 up-conversion luminescence nanoparticles were synthesized.The samples were characterized by X-ray diffraction(XRD),scanning electron microscope(SEM),infrared spectrometer(FT-IR) and fluorescence(FL) spectrum.The effect of annealing temperature and the concentration of Dy3+ co-doping on the crystal structure,morphology and luminescence properties were investigated.The absorption spectra shows that the absorption peak band centered at 776 nm corresponds to 6H15/2→6F5/2 transition of Dy3+ ion.Under 776 nm excitation,the NaYF4∶Dy3+can emit strong green and blue emission.The blue emitting light results from the transition of 4F9/2→6H15/2 of Dy3+,green emitting light is from the transition of 4F9/2→ 6H13/2 of Dy3+.XRD analyses show that the UCNPs are pure cubic phase NaYF4 nanocrystals.
